    Blue got a reaction from Gruff in Tangerine Army.   
    Not really sure how you can compare trainers. Firstly purchasing "top" priced yearlings is no guarantee of success. Walker hasn;t had the luxury of  the likes of Avantage, Melody Belle or Probabeel. Promising two and three year old fillies from the previous season didn't really come up this season for whatever reason. On the other hand he's won a bloody lot of lower grade races, especially maidens, with largely untried three and four year olds that Jamie did very little with. A number of these were in the winter last year when the stable had previously gone into hibernation, plus a few over the jumps - a relatively new venture. All in all 170 odd winners with three months of the season still to run is hard to disparage. Just mho.
